Understanding Betting Portal Functionality
Betting portals act as aggregators of information, bringing together details from a multitude of bookmakers under one roof. This centralized approach offers several key advantages. Instead of visiting numerous individual websites to compare odds, users can quickly and easily assess the best available prices for their desired events. Beyond odds comparison, many portals offer detailed reviews of betting sites, assessing their user interface, payment options, customer support, and overall reliability. These reviews are often based on extensive testing and user feedback, providing a valuable perspective for potential customers. The functionality extends to providing bonus information, promotional offers, and sometimes even exclusive deals.
A core element of a successful betting portal is its commitment to providing unbiased and accurate data. This requires a dedicated team of researchers and analysts who are constantly monitoring the market and updating the platform's information. The platform should also employ robust security measures to protect user data and ensure a safe browsing experience. Consider the scope – does the portal cover a wide range of sports, or does it specialize in certain niches? Does it cater to different betting preferences, such as pre-match or in-play betting? The answers to these questions will help determine whether a particular portal meets your specific needs.

Evaluating the Quality of Bookmaker Listings
Not all betting portals are created equal. The quality of bookmaker listings is a key indicator of a portal’s credibility. A credible portal does not simply list every available bookmaker; it carefully curates its selection based on factors such as licensing, reputation, and security. It’s essential to ensure that all listed bookmakers are properly licensed and regulated by reputable authorities. Ideally, the portal will provide information about the licensing jurisdiction for each bookmaker, allowing users to verify their legitimacy independently. Furthermore, a reliable portal will have a clear policy regarding responsible gambling, promoting safe betting practices and providing links to support organizations.
A thorough evaluation should also consider the range of sports and betting markets offered by the listed bookmakers. Does the portal cater to niche sports, or does it primarily focus on popular events like football and horse racing? Does it offer a diverse range of betting options, such as accumulators, system bets, and in-play betting? The more comprehensive the selection, the better. Evaluating the quality of bookmaker listings also involves assessing the terms and conditions associated with bonuses and promotions. Are the wagering requirements reasonable? Are there any hidden fees or restrictions? A transparent and user-friendly presentation of these details is crucial.
Key Considerations for Responsible Gambling
A responsible betting portal integrates tools and resources to promote responsible gambling. This includes providing links to organizations that offer help and support for problem gamblers, such as GamCare and BeGambleAware. The best portals also allow users to set de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ion periods. These features empower individuals to control their spending and prevent gambling from becoming a problem. A portal should also offer educational content about responsible gambling, raising awareness of the risks involved and providing tips for staying in control. It is about encouraging safe betting habits and providing resources for those who may need help.

Understanding Odds and Betting Markets
A good betting portal goes beyond simply listing odds; it provides explanations of different betting markets and odds formats. Understanding these concepts is crucial for making informed betting decisions. Different betting markets offer varying levels of risk and reward. For example, a win-draw-win market is a relatively straightforward option, while more complex markets, such as handicap betting or correct score betting, require a deeper understanding of the sport and the teams involved. The portal should explain these markets in clear, concise language, making them accessible to beginners. Understanding odds formats – decimal, fractional, and American – is also crucial, allowing you to compare prices accurately. A tool to convert between these formats can be very helpful.
Furthermore, a valuable portal might offer statistical analysis and expert predictions to help users assess the probabilities of different outcomes. This could include form guides, team news, and historical data. However, it’s important to remember that these are just tools to aid your decision-making; they should not be relied upon as guarantees of success. The best betting decisions are based on a combination of research, analysis, and intuition. The portal can suggest resources for further research, such as sports news websites and statistical databases.
